Solid NDP win cements Kinew as 1st First Nations premier in Manitoba history

[ https://www.cbc.ca/news/canada/manitoba ... 13_1270529 ]

New Democrats emerge with enough seats to form majority government

Bryce Hoye · CBC News · Posted: Oct 03, 2023 8:00 PM CDT

The NDP sailed to victory Tuesday night with a solid win that cements leader Wab Kinew as Manitoba's first First Nations premier and also nets the party enough seats to form a majority government.

"This is a great victory for all of us in Manitoba," Kinew said to thunderous applause at NDP campaign headquarters Tuesday night, after leading his party to a win in Fort Rouge.

"We can do amazing things when we stand together as one province." . . . .
